#68499e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#68499e is composed of 40.8% red, 28.6% green and 62%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 34.2% cyan, 53.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 38% black. It has a hue angle of 261.9 degrees, a saturation of 36.8% and a lightness of 45.3%. #68499e color hex could be obtained by blending #d092ff with #00003d.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

● #68499e color description : Dark moderate violet.
#68499e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#68499e has RGB values of R:104, G:73, B:158 and CMYK values of C:0.34, M:0.54, Y:0, K:0.38. Its decimal value is 6834590.
